Every time I start up the computer, I get an error message that says there
was a corrupt file in the Recycle Bin would you like to delete it? I say yes
and it says that it can't be deleted and asks if I would like to retry or
cancel. If you hit retry it just circles back to the same question of
wanting to retry or cancel. If you hit cancel, then the issue goes away,
until you try to empty your Recycle Bin. Also something that is strange; if
you open the Recycle Bin or look at the icon on the desktop, you'll notice
that it's empty.

I've checked the settings and have restored to the default settings. Any
ideas???

Thank you for your time!
Hi Berns,

The only thing I can think of is to try running the command "sfc /scannow" in a elevated command prompt. It may fix it for you. You can look here for details on it.
